Kingdom is a Japanese historical manga series written and illustrated by Yasuhisa Hara. It has been serialized in Shueisha's Weekly Young Jump magazine since 2006. ui.x_scoring_methodology"Demon Slayer: Kimetsu no Yaiba" is a Japanese manga series written and illustrated by Koyoharu Gotouge, serialized in Weekly Shōnen Jump from 2016 to 2020. ui.x_scoring_methodologyFire Punch is a Japanese post-apocalyptic dark fantasy manga series written and illustrated by Tatsuki Fujimoto. Serialized on the Shonen Jump+ online platform from 2016 to 2018, it is recognized as a significant early work by the creator, predating his highly popular series Chainsaw Man. The story...
